What is the importance of the flying stick in the Totonac culture?
The flying stick is a ceremonial ritual practiced by the Totonacas, an indigenous group of Mexico, which has its origins in pre-Hispanic times. It consists of climbing a tall pole, tying oneself with ropes and jumping into the void while spinning around the pole, symbolizing the connection between earth and sky, as well as fertility and renewal. It is a sacred tradition that is carried out on special occasions and religious holidays.
